<P>PROBLEM TO BE SOLVED: To obtain an image of high quality, having proper solid filling by enhancing the development contribution ratio of a toner, regardless of the size of the diameter of a photoreceptor and making image density in a solid part high. <P>SOLUTION: When the height of a head of a developer on a developing sleeve 111a at a magnetic field zero point, in which magnetic force of a developing main magnetic pole is zero, is h and a developing gap at the nearest distance between the developing sleeve 111a and a photoreceptor drum 1 is a, a=h is satisfied. Image quality evaluation is performed, in combination with the photoreceptor drum 1 changing the outside diameter and the developing sleeve 111a, by changing h and an angle from the developing gap to the magnetic field zero point, and a proper or optimum value or range is selected from the result of the image quality evaluation to set various conditions. When a distance from the magnetic field zero point on a line segment b, passing through the magnetic field zero point to the photoreceptor drum 1, by passing through the rotation center of the developing sleeve 111a and in parallel with a magnetic field center line e, combined to the magnetic field center of the developing main magnetic pole is L, the size of L is measured to make the measured value cope with the image quality evaluation, and a proper or optimum value or the range for the size of L is selected. <P>COPYRIGHT: (C)2003,JPO |
